David lamp
Illuminate your space with a fusion of classical elegance and modern digital distortion. The David Lamp is a striking lighting fixture that reimagines Michelangelo’s masterpiece through a fluid, topographical lens, turning a timeless bust into a functional work of glowing art.
Design & Concept:
I designed this lamp to explore how light interacts with complex, organic surfaces. The silhouette of David is transformed by deep horizontal ripples that flow across the facial features, creating a "wavering" effect that feels alive when illuminated.
This project is more than just a sculpture; it is a dedicated light housing. The top of the bust is designed with a specific opening to accommodate a lamp socket, allowing the light to spill out from the crown of the head. This creates a dramatic upwards glow while highlighting the intricate "wave" textures of the face and hair in high relief.
